Federal Appeals Court Halts Trump Independent Agency Firings Spurring a Supreme Court Battle

A federal appeals court flipped on President Trump’s firings of two independent agency leaders, temporarily reinstating them Monday and likely setting up a battle at the Supreme Court.
In a 7-4 vote, the full U.S. Court of Appeals for the District of Columbia Circuit wiped a ruling from a three-judge panel on the court that sided with the government late last month by greenlighting Trump’s firings of Merit Systems Protection Board member Cathy Harris and Gwynne Wilcox, a member of the National Labor Relations Board.
